What is Duplicator?
Duplicator is a plugin that simplifies the task of creating backups and migrating your WordPress website to a different location. With Duplicator, you can make a complete copy of your website, including themes, plugins, and all other site content. You can then save the backup files on your computer or in the cloud for safekeeping.
Downloading Two Files with Duplicator
Duplicator requires you to download two files: the installer and the archive. The installer file is what you will use to install your site on a new location, while the archive file is the backup of your website.
Here's how to download the two files:
Step 1: Install and Activate Duplicator
The first step in using Duplicator is to install and activate the plugin. You can do this by going to your WordPress dashboard and searching for "Duplicator" in the plugins area. Click "Install Now," and then activate the plugin.
Step 2: Create a New Package
Once Duplicator is activated, go to the plugin's settings menu and click on "Packages." Click on "Create New" to start a new backup. Follow the wizard to configure your package, including the name, storage location, and other settings.
Step 3: Build the Package
After you've set up your package, click on "Build" to start the backup process. This may take a few minutes, depending on the size of your site.
Step 4: Download the Files
Once the backup is complete, you will need to download the two backup files: the installer and the archive. To do this, click on "Installer" to download the installer file, and then click on "Archive" to download the backup file.
Step 5: Store the Files
Save these files in a safe location, such as your computer or cloud storage. Make sure to keep them somewhere where you can easily access them when you need to restore your site.
